2. Who Can Apply for 2025 Registration at CUT?
CUT opens its doors to South African and international students who meet the admission criteria for the respective programs they wish to study. However, to ensure that your application is successful, you need to fulfill certain requirements.
A. Undergraduate Programs
To apply for an undergraduate program at CUT, you must meet the following basic requirements:
- National Senior Certificate (NSC) with a minimum level of achievement required for the program you are applying for.
- Mathematics and Science subjects may be required for certain programs, particularly in the engineering or IT fields.
- Admission Point Score (APS): Each program has a minimum APS requirement, calculated based on your matriculation results.
B. Postgraduate Programs
For postgraduate applicants, the requirements include:
- A relevant undergraduate degree or equivalent qualification.
- Proof of academic excellence, such as your final year grades or an academic transcript.
- Additional documentation may be requested, such as research proposals or letters of recommendation, depending on the program.
C. International Students
International students must meet specific visa and academic entry requirements. They must have completed high school or university education equivalent to the South African National Senior Certificate (NSC).
D. Mature Age Applicants
Mature age applicants (those who are 23 years or older) may apply for certain programs even if they do not meet the standard matriculation requirements. These applicants must provide evidence of work experience or other qualifications.
3. The CUT Registration Process for 2025
The registration process at CUT for the 2025 academic year involves several key steps. It’s important to follow each step carefully to avoid any delays or confusion during the process.
A. Step 1: Check Admission Requirements
Before you apply, carefully review the specific entry requirements for the course you wish to study. CUT provides detailed information on the CUT website about the entry requirements, including any specific subjects or scores you need to have achieved in your previous studies.
B. Step 2: Complete the Online Application
CUT encourages all prospective students to apply online through the official CUT website. The application portal is easy to navigate, and you can track the status of your application throughout the process.
The online application typically requires you to:
- Fill in your personal details.
- Submit academic transcripts or matriculation results.
- Provide a valid email address for communication purposes.
- Upload any supporting documents, such as ID or passport copies and proof of payment for the application fee (if applicable).
The application fee for South African and international students may vary, so check the CUT website for the latest information on payment details.
C. Step 3: Submit Supporting Documents
Once you’ve filled out your online application, ensure that all required supporting documents are submitted. These typically include:
- Certified copies of your ID or passport.
- Matriculation certificate or academic transcript.
- Proof of payment for the application fee.
- Any additional documents required for international students or specific programs.
Ensure that all documents are submitted in accordance with CUT’s requirements. Missing or incomplete documentation can lead to delays or disqualification from the application process.
D. Step 4: Await Acceptance Notification
After submitting your application, CUT will process it and send you an acceptance notification if you meet the program’s criteria. If you are accepted, you will receive an offer to register for your chosen program.
The acceptance letter will include further instructions on registration, fees, and deadlines. It is crucial to pay attention to these details to avoid missing important registration dates.
E. Step 5: Register Online
Once you’ve received your acceptance offer, you can proceed with online registration. This involves:
- Confirming your acceptance of the offer.
- Paying the required registration fees.
- Choosing your subjects or modules for the semester.
You will also receive an official student number and access to your student portal, where you can track your academic progress, check timetables, and manage payments.
F. Step 6: Pay Fees
Before your registration is fully complete, you will need to settle any outstanding fees, including tuition fees, accommodation costs, and other relevant charges. Payment can be made via various methods, including bank transfer, credit card, or at the CUT fee office.
Ensure you are aware of the payment deadlines to avoid any late fees or delays in starting your classes.
G. Step 7: Collect Your Student ID and Materials
After completing your online registration and payment, you will be able to collect your student ID card. You may also be required to pick up any learning materials, such as textbooks or module packs, from the university.
